MikroBrain: Network automation and edge infrastructure

CLOUD & PLATFORM INTEGRATION / EDGE & EMBEDDED

MikroBrain is a platform being developed to automate the deployment, management, and operation of network and edge infrastructure at scale. Originally focused on MikroTik environments, the vision extends toward secure fleet management, automation workflows, configuration intelligence, and large-scale infrastructure operations.

Active DevelopmentMikroTik-FirstMulti-TenantWireGuard-Secured
MikroBrain: Network automation and edge infrastructure architecture
Edge & OS
Embedded LinuxFlatcarA/B OTARouterOSOpenWRTOPNsense
Backend
FastAPIDockerRabbitMQRedis
Data & UI
MongoDBReact
Networking & Security
WireGuardSSH Automation

The Problem

Managing distributed infrastructure remains unnecessarily complex. Organizations operating multiple sites face manual router configuration, limited visibility across deployments, mounting operational overhead as fleets grow, vendor-specific tooling with poor interoperability, and fragmented workflows between networking and edge teams.

As infrastructure becomes increasingly distributed, operational tooling has struggled to keep up.

The Goal

Create a unified platform that securely operates edge infrastructure at scale, simplifying fleet operations, automating repetitive tasks, reducing configuration drift and human error, and bridging networking and embedded-systems operations.

Operate infrastructure from a single control plane rather than managing thousands of independent devices.

WHAT IT DOES

Core Capabilities

Secure Connectivity

Devices establish encrypted outbound tunnels to the platform, keeping infrastructure centralized with nothing exposed publicly.

Fleet Management

Operate distributed routers and edge devices from one interface, with multi-tenant support and role-based access.

Automation Engine

Automate configuration deployment, backups, command execution, provisioning and operational workflows.

Auditability & Governance

Every operation is traceable, giving full visibility into configuration changes and operational activity.

HOW IT'S BUILT

Architecture

01

Cloud Layer

Orchestration, device management, authentication, automation workflows, data storage and multi-tenant management.

02

Connectivity Layer

Secure overlay networking with WireGuard, tenant isolation and secure remote access.

03

Edge Layer

MikroTik, OpenWrt, OPNsense, embedded Linux, IoT gateways and remote compute nodes.

WHO IT'S FOR

Use Cases

Managed Service Providers

Centralized operations across many customer environments.

IoT Platforms

Securely manage gateways and distributed edge devices.

Building & Industrial

Connect and orchestrate infrastructure deployed across multiple sites.

Distributed Enterprises

Standardize operations across geographically distributed locations.

WHERE IT'S GOING

Roadmap

NOW

Network Automation

  • MikroTik fleet management
  • Configuration automation
  • Backup & recovery workflows
  • Multi-tenant management
  • Secure connectivity
NEXT

Beyond MikroTik

  • OpenWrt & OPNsense onboarding
  • Embedded Linux fleet management
  • Edge CI/CD pipelines
VISION

Unified Edge Platform

  • One control plane for all infrastructure
  • Connect, manage, automate & orchestrate at the edge

Vision

Infrastructure is becoming increasingly distributed, and networking, compute, IoT and embedded systems are converging at the edge. MikroBrain aims to become the operational layer that connects them — a unified platform to securely connect, manage, automate and orchestrate infrastructure wherever it exists.

Project Status

Currently under active development. Focus areas include expanding automation capabilities, improving the multi-tenant architecture, OpenWrt integration, and edge orchestration.

See MikroBrain in action

Scroll to Top